Takapuna “Classics” Still Prove Popular
A HEAVY ENTRY LIST Nominations closed yesterday for events to bo run respectively at the spring and summer meetings of the Takapuna Jockey Club, and are very satisfactory—ll2 being entered for the Takapuna Plato and 105 for the Wynyard Plate.
